After having them for about 2 weeks now, the color shift is evident. They've changed now from a it of a yellowish/green tinge to like a complete white with a hint of blue now. I'm realyl impressed with the color and brightness. So far, the closest car I can compare the color too is an Infiniti QX4 with HID's. Liek a Pathfinder kinda thing, but Infiniti.
